Known in the Dark Without Pretense
The house has gone quiet, but your heart is pounding so hard it feels like it might give you away. You hear the footsteps stop right outside your door, and suddenly your own breathing sounds like a storm you cannot calm.
You hold your breath, trying to make yourself small enough to disappear into the mattress, terrified that the rhythm of your fear is too loud to hide. But listen — the One walking the halls of your life does not need you to pretend you are asleep.
He is not looking for a performance of peace; He is looking for you. You do not have to slow your breath to be loved.
The light is already on the other side of that door, not to scold the noise, but to sit with you in the dark until your soul remembers it is safe. The panic says you are exposed; the truth says you are known, and being known is the only place where you can finally rest.
